Introduction to Steel Wool

Steel wool is a versatile and effective tool known for its numerous applications in cleaning and maintenance across various surfaces. Comprised of thin strands of steel fibers, it is highly effective due to its abrasiveness, making it suitable for tackling tough cleaning jobs. Cleaning in Automotive Areas

When it comes to maintaining the cleanliness and appearance of your vehicle, steel wool proves to be an invaluable tool. In automotive areas, it is particularly useful for removing rust from metal components, ensuring that surfaces are prepared for painting or coating. Additionally, steel wool can effectively clean greasy parts under the hood and help restore the shine of chrome and metal surfaces. Furniture Restoration and Care

Steel wool is also a favorite among DIY enthusiasts and professionals when it comes to furniture restoration. Its gentle abrasiveness allows for the effective removal of dirt and grime without damaging the underlying finish. When working with wooden furniture, steel wool can assist in polishing, helping to bring out the natural beauty of the wood grain. For those crafting furniture items, steel wool serves as a great tool for smoothing surfaces, preparing them for stains or finishes that enhance color and durability.

Wood Craft and Metal Pipe Applications

Woodworking projects often require precision and a fine finish, which is where steel wool shines. It removes imperfections on surfaces, allowing for a smoother application of varnish or paint. Steel wool comes in different grades, enabling craftsmen to choose the appropriate coarseness to suit their project needs. Similarly, when addressing issues related to metal pipes, steel wool's effectiveness in removing rust and corrosion makes it an essential component in maintenance routines. Whether it's for plumbing fixtures or decorative metalwork, using steel wool can prolong the integrity of the metal surfaces.
